### "A rigid platform that limits functionality and lacks staff support"

November 26, 2024

2.0

Pros

MemberClicks is low in complexity and serves as a bare bones association management system that offers the bare minimum in features and functionality. If you are in need of a simple database to execute the most basic functions (i.e., membership applications, registration for simple events and programs, an online learning library, etc.), then MemberClicks is the database for your small to mid-size organization.

Cons

MemberClicks is unfortunately lacking in a variety of areas, with cons outweighing the pros. - Customer service: MemberClicks guards who can ask their staff support-related questions. You can only have 1-2 staff serve as "super admins" who have access to reach out to MemberClicks for support. Our organization's experience has been frustrating in that we have received slow responses for questions, and there is not a lot of problem-solving or customization on MemberClicks' side for specific problems or ideas, beyond sending us pre-written help articles. I understand the concept of having 1-2 staff liaisons per association to make the line of communication easier on both sides; however, adhering to it in such a rigid manner does not always work for the association staff. For instance, on my team, our "super admin" does not do anything with event management or registrations, and mainly focuses on membership. I personally serve as the team's event manager and need to be able to speak with someone directly about ways to improve our registration process, but have been told I am not able to do so as I do not have administrator privileges. About a year ago, our team met with a MemberClicks representative who began the meeting by telling us we selected the wrong topic to discuss with her, and did not seem enthusiastic to answer our questions on the call. All of this makes me feel like our staff is more of an inconvenience than a customer. - Rigid, and non-flexible database: Unlike other platforms, MemberClicks seems rigid with most of its functionality. Since my primary job function is event management, let's focus on that. It seems that the only way to register someone for an event is through their forms feature, which forces an individual to go through filling out an entire, built-out form to be able to register for an annual conference, for instance. At least for the version we pay for, there does not seem to be a more interactive registration experience, and the user interface of the form is rather bland and "clunky," forcing the attendee to answer a list of questions built-out on the form. I wish that MemberClicks was more object-based. For example, rather than a long registration form for a conference where we have to include multiple questions around event add-ons (optional tours, dine arounds, etc.), I wish we could create separate, purchase-able "items", where they can pick and pay for different conference passes and add-ons as they please. It is difficult to do things like sell spouse-only passes on the same registration form as normal attendees, because for the initial question where an attendee selects a pass type, we want all of their corresponding attendee data to pull out separately with their filled out form, and MemberClicks only pulls data by number of times a form has been filled out. I also wish there was an easier way for member profiles to automatically update with information entered on the registration form for an event. It would also be nice for members to log into their profile and see which upcoming events they are signed up for versus simply if they have filled out/taken a "form." There are so many limitations since this database is not very interconnected or object-based. - Article management: The process of updating various web pages in the backend of MemberClicks is difficult. You have to try several times to click or highlight text until you are able to format it in the desired manner. Most of the web pages are managed and edited through MemberClicks, which leaves a very unappealing user experience and poor web design. I am sure a lot of the above has to do with the plan that our organization pays for and the fact that we don't have an expert on our staff who is solely dedicated to database issues; however, I feel these comments are valid as MemberClicks looks to improve its software and service offerings.

### "Poor Support, Functionality, and Treatment"

November 3, 2023

1.0

Pros

Wonderful product for small company upon purchase - and for several years worked great! Wonderful support and features were commiserate with fees.

Cons

Beginning in 2020, the service/support began to wane. When requesting support, the delays were codified in the messages -- "We'll get back to you as soon as we're able to." This went on for more than a year. We had to set calendar invites for 7 days out just to remember to resend the help emails. Fees went up by 5% for two years in a row, then more than 20% in 2023. This was not allowed by our agreement (which had capped increases to 5%), but the parent company (Personify) changed the terms & conditions to allow themselves to break their own contract. No additional features or functions were provided; we were so excited to engage with the client success team, only for our representative (and apparently the whole team) to be laid off. We discontinued our service last month, but because we were within the 60-day window, they charged us for the entire year. Turns out that they had changed that term as well in March 2023. When we asked to speak with someone, they said "We don't provide phone support." Mind you, their leading phase in their customer mission is... "We talk with you." When a company with which you've had a long-term relationship punishes a loyal, paying customer like this, one is left only to be committed to ensure that no other leader is left to feel like we do. Please, caution is advised.

### "New version is GREAT!"

March 2, 2017

4.0

We've been with Memberclicks for a few years and when we started using it we were really disappointed - from the data migration that took over a month to the implementation that took four months and a HUGE chunk of time, to features that didn't work the way we needed. Then a year ago - BANG - new reality! They released an entirely rebuilt database system to some early adopters (including us) and the implementation was FULLY supported (though it took a while, apparently our needs are complicated) and the new platform is great! The staff clearly took all of their clients' feedback and suggestions and recommendations, and continue to do so, and continue to build features and weed out bugs quickly. The customer service staff clearly has new energy - they're incredibly helpful and responsive by email. One major issue is that it does NOT have an API right now - so no talking to other databases. We use MC to manage our complex membership structure (mix of organizations and individuals, with different tiers and a variety of dues structures) and our event registration (we do about 20 events per year). We also use it as our "membership only" website so members can login and self-serve, and as our email blast client. The best feature in my opinion (as membership manager) is the automated renewal invoices. Our bookkeeper likes the way payments can be posted and reports run on transactions. Our communications director likes how easy the "contact center" is to use with the exception that saved messages are stored by their subject line (e.g. rather than labelling a message "BOE Event 2-25-16" it uses the subject line "Join us for nonprofit fundraising workshop" which makes searching problematic.) Our administrative assistant likes how easily you can set up organization-to-individual relationships, and how that's automated when someone takes the Membership Application form online (though there are a few bugs there.) Overall they system is pretty easy to learn and has lots of flexibility and user-controlled or defined aspects. The flexibility makes implementation arduous - you have to set permissions for every member type for every attribute in the database itself and again for public directories and webpages. The MC team walk you through it and can do a lot of the work for you but your prep on defining processes/workflows is crucial. Overall I'd recommend MC - just be clear about what it is you NEED a system to do and what you want a system to do for you.

Pros

Easy to learn as a regular user, lots of flexibility and user-defined workflows, responsive customer service, easy to send email blasts, lots of intuitive features - things tend to be located where you would naturally look for them. It's pretty powerful, particularly for the price point. I like how much is automated and that you can control a lot of it when you have special circumstances. We have fewer work-arounds than I've ever had with a database.

Cons

Complexity of internal setup and interaction between different modules - just a lot to learn and track so you make sure the right members get the right messages. Definitely need at least one staff person who is a "super user" to get it all sorted in the beginning and keep it running when changes happen/new features are released. Our membership structure is really complicated so keeping track of all the different permissions and testing workflows is crucial and time consuming. The lack of API is really annoying, though I'm told that's coming soon. It's also annoying that custom attributes (e.g. our member numbers which apply to organizations, not individuals) don't "cascade" from org-level profiles to their linked individual profiles. MC has an automated member number system but it assigns a unique member number to each profile. That makes uploads/data cleanup easier, but since we have one number to cover all the people working for a given organization, we don't use that feature - we have a manual process work-around which is annoying.
